Miller Act Of 1935: What is the Meaning of Miller Act Of 1935?
Definition of Miller Act Of 1935: The Miller Act is a federal law (40 U.S.C. Section 270a-270d-1) that generally requires contractors to be paid and performance guarantees for the construction, modification or repair of buildings. This law applies to more than 100,000 federal contracts.
